In-Club Galleries: A New Entertainment Frontier

Hi Ibiza, a club that’s been crowned the world’s best for four years running, just launched the first permanent art gallery within a club. Partnering with Ibiza-based nightlife group The Night League, the gallery showcases works by famous digital artists like Beeple and Mad Dog Jones. The space is filled with a curated mix of digital and physical art, interactive installations, and custom display tech, creating an unparalleled atmosphere where nightlife meets art.

This isn’t an isolated event. Similar in-club galleries have popped up globally, like Bright Moments’ NFT gallery in Venice and the Web3 NYC Gallery in New York. They’re changing how we consume art, making it more interactive and integrated into our nightlife experiences.

Crypto Startups: A Treasure Trove of Monetization Opportunities

Bringing nightlife and digital art together opens up fresh monetization opportunities for crypto startups. Using blockchain and NFTs can help create innovative revenue streams that go beyond ticket sales. For instance, NFT-based tickets can help eliminate scalping and counterfeiting, while allowing resale royalties to return to artists and organizers. This new model not only boosts earnings but also establishes a direct connection between creators and fans, bypassing old intermediaries.

Real-time monetization through live streaming adds another layer, giving artists instant support tokens from fans during broadcasts. This immediacy is crucial for building a loyal fanbase and securing long-term earnings.

NFTs and Blockchain: Creating Unique Fan Engagement

Integrating NFTs into nightlife experiences strengthens artist-audience connections. You can offer exclusive experiences tied to events—like limited-edition digital collectibles—creating deeper community ties. Blockchain tech adds transparency and security to transactions, enhancing trust.

Crypto startups can also offer fractional ownership of digital art through tokens, making art more accessible and encouraging ongoing fan interaction. This not only democratizes access but also fosters loyalty, which is essential for any entertainment venture.

The Future: New Revenue Streams on the Horizon

As the NFT market matures, expect to see the blend of digital art and nightlife pick up steam. A dip in speculative trading volumes hints that the focus might shift from hype-driven sales to artist-centered experiences. In-club galleries are leading this charge, turning digital art from a solitary screen experience into a collective, vibrant event.

The future of digital art in nightlife will likely bring new monetization models, including microtransactions and dynamic pricing. This approach will cater to diverse audience preferences, amplifying the overall entertainment experience.
